Interactive Join Query Inference with JIM

Summary: JIM interactively infers n-ary join predicates from user-labeled positive/negative result tuples, targeting joins across disparate sources and weak metadata. It identifies uninformative tuples and adaptively selects queries to minimize user interactions. (summarized by gpt-5.6-luna on Jul 24 2026)
